Indicative prices in London
In London, observed price ranges are slightly higher than the national average (+20 %), reflecting urban pressure and local logistics costs.
| Product | Purchase | Long-term rental |
|---|---|---|
| 20 ft dry container | £2,258 – £5,670 | £105 – £158/month |
| 40 ft dry container | £2,888 – £6,930 | £158 – £263/month |
| High cube shipping container 40ft | £3,255 – £7,823 | £210 – £263/month |
| Reefer shipping container 20' | £6,930 – £17,640 | £578 – £893/month |
| Site bungalow (15 m²) | £5,670 – £17,640 | £210 – £420/month |
Estimated prices for Q1 2026 adjusted by local factor. Excluding delivery from London Gateway port (Thurrock) ou Tilbury, excluding rental deposit, excluding specific connections.
